Abstract

This letter proposes a cooperative caching placement framework for coordinated multi-point joint transmission and single cell transmission, to minimize content transmission time for mobile users. The optimization problem is NP-hard. We thus transform it into a local altruistic game, and propose two evolved Spatial Adaptive Play (SAP) algorithms: the first one overcomes the main limitation of the traditional SAP that large action sets pose an unsurmountable computational burden; the second one further expedites escape from convergence traps caused by fake Nash Equilibria. Numerical results conducted based on a real-world LTE traffic data set have validated the performance of our proposed algorithms.
